Transaction 52ffed41a462968eed10719b41fc4f2710824f7143a443bf2821ae70c01ba267

block
7076b8ec627d7e0a18feb7db25098c4b49771a4b4ad9f6f1d31f7d5bdde0937e

2 Inputs

4 Outputs